Felixstowe to Lea Bridge by train

A train trip from Felixstowe to Lea Bridge takes about 2hrs 46 mins on average, covering roughly 65 miles (105 kilometres). With around 18 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£11.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

What are my cheap ticket options for Felixstowe to Lea Bridge journ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Felixstowe to Lea Bridge start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Felixstowe to Lea Bridge start from £53.80 one way, or £54.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Felixstowe to Lea Bridge are available for £65.00 one way, or £78.30 return

Facilities and Amenities at Felixstowe Station

At Felixstowe train station, travelers will find ticket machines readily available to purchase and collect pre-bought tickets. These machines are accessible to everyone, including those with mobility challenges, thanks to the station's step-free access and the provision of induction loops. The station prides itself on being user-friendly, even without a staffed ticket office.

While there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ities at the station, passengers can utilize the seating area on the platform. The station is well-equipped with CCTV for added security, and help points ensure assistance is always within reach. Although luggage storage and cycle hire options are not available, the station does provide substantial bicycle storage, making it convenient for cycling enthusiasts and commuters alike.

Facilities and Amenities at Lea Bridge

Despite the lack of a ticket office, Lea Bridge is equipped with user-friendly ticket machines from which you can effortlessly collect pre-purchased tickets. These machines are conveniently located at the bottom of the stairs leading to Platform 1, providing easy access to all travelers, including those with mobility issues. Furthermore, the presence of smartcard validators caters to modern commuting needs, even though smartcards aren't issued at this station.

Help points and departure screens ensure that assistance and information are always at hand—proving quite advantageous for any last-minute travel plans. Security is uncompromised with CCTV coverage yet, it's slightly disappointing that the station lacks some amenities like waiting rooms, seating areas, and refreshment facilities. Nonetheless, step-free access to platforms and staff-trained to assist passengers with disabilities, maintain a high level of accessibility.
